Pune: From October 24 to November 10 i.e. from Dasara (Dussera) to Dhanatrayodashi (Dhanteras) festivals, the Regional Transport Office (RTO) Pune witnessed a rise in registrations of Petrol and Diesel vehicles compared to 2022. However, there has been a decrease in the electric vehicle registrations.
As per information shared by Sanjeev Bhor, Deputy Commissioner, RTO Pune, during this year’s Dussehra to Dhanatrayodashi period (October 24 to November 10), there has been an increase in the registration of petrol and diesel vehicles but a dip in the registrations of electric vehicles.
Following is the number of newly registered vehicles from Dussera to Dhanatrayodashi:
Fuel Vehicles New Registration | |||||||
Date | Motorcycles | Cars | Goods | Auto Rickshaws | Buses | Taxis | Total |
October 5, 2022 to October 22, 2022 | 12413 | 4564 | 844 | 745 | 48 | 210 | 18824 |
October 24, 2023 to November 10, 2023 | 12971 | 4557 | 867 | 1045 | 82 | 561 | 20083 |
Electric Vehicles New Registration | |||||||
Date | Motorcycles | Cars | Goods | Auto Rickshaws | Buses | Taxis | Total |
October 5, 2022 to October 22, 2022 | 1781 | 127 | 14 | 7 | 0 | 0 | 1929 |
October 24, 2023 to November 10, 2023 | 1526 | 111 | 34 | 1 | 15 | 15 | 1702 |
